Antipsychotics
A class of medication primarily used to manage psychosis, including delusions, hallucinations, schizophrenia, and bipolar disorder, among other mental health conditions.
Dopamine Receptors
Specialized proteins located in the brain and elsewhere that dopamine binds to, playing a crucial role in the modulation of various neurological processes such as reward and movement.
Brain Maturation
Brain maturation involves the developmental processes that lead to the functional organization and the fully mature state of the brain.
Hippocampus
A crucial part of the brain's limbic system involved in memory formation, navigation, and the regulation of emotional responses.
